Transaction 2320ea6600397058a2c5a758bbca416ba74761834fd7f4be000e59c63cd631ef

1 Input
2 Outputs
  • 2320ea6600397058a2c5a758bbca416ba74761834fd7f4be000e59c63cd631ef:0
  • value  16251638
    address  3QZowUFh33Zhusi4VbNpdxbGME2LZxswKG
  • 2320ea6600397058a2c5a758bbca416ba74761834fd7f4be000e59c63cd631ef:1
  • value  236285438
    address  3JKAJ6XmhtRDh6wNKV3V1PxiChMy3MDyPS